12 strikes and 3 general strikes: the education unions escalate the conflict in Catalonia

USTEC, Aspepc, CGT and Intersindical call for a month of strikes between May and June after a consultation with more than 31,000 responses and warn the Govern that the school year will not end normally if it does not reopen negotiations.

The education unions critical of the agreement between Educació, CCOO and UGT have announced a cycle of strikes for one month, between May and June, with the intention of intensifying the conflict in the third quarter. The call comes from the union majority formed by USTEC, Aspepc, CGT and the Intersindical and arrives after a massive consultation with the teaching staff that received more than 31,000 responses.

The protest will follow the same model as the March strike, although with more strike days. The bulk of the calendar will be articulated with 12 territorialized strikes, to which will be added three days of general strike throughout Catalonia and two specific days for infant staff from 0 to 3 years old, that is to say, of the nursery schools.

Calendar of strikes between May and June

The calendar starts in May with two sessions aimed at staff aged 0 to 3 years, scheduled for Thursday 7 and Wednesday 20. Between both dates, the unions have set a unitary demonstration for all of Catalonia for Tuesday 12.

That same month, territorialized strikes have been scheduled in different demarcations. On Wednesday 13, Baix Llobregat and Penedès are called to strike. On Thursday 14, it will be the turn of Girona and Catalunya Central. On Friday 15, Lleida and Alt Pirineu i l"Aran.

The call will continue on Monday 18 in the Consorci de Barcelona and the Barcelonès, and on Tuesday 19 in the Maresme, the Vallès Occidental and the Vallès Oriental. On Thursday 21 the strike day has been set in the Camp de Tarragona and the Terres de l"Ebre. Additionally, on Wednesday 27 a Catalan-wide strike has been called.

In June, new territorialized days are planned. Monday 1st in Girona and the Catalunya Central. Tuesday 2nd in the Consorci de Barcelona and the Barcelonès. Wednesday 3rd in the Camp de Tarragona and the Terres de l'Ebre. Thursday 4th in Lleida and the Alt Pirineu i l'Aran. Friday 5th another unitary demonstration for all of Cataluña will be held.

Rejection of the agreement and warning to the Govern

During a press conference held this Tuesday morning, the representatives of the teaching collective rejected the so-called country agreement. The conveners maintain that it does not respond to the real needs of the centers nor of the teaching staff.

"The educational community has spoken clearly. The country agreement has been massively rejected and does does not respond to the real needs of the centers nor of the teaching staff" - Union spokespersons, teaching collective

The unions have warned that, if the Govern does not commit to reopening negotiations and does not present a proposal they consider worthy, the school year will not end normally. They have also called on the educational community to get involved in the zone assemblies, strengthen the school ones, and prepare a sustained mobilization.

Faculty Claims

Among the main demands of the conveners is the recovery of the purchasing power of the teaching staff and the guarantee of decent wages. They also demand an increase in educational investment to reduce class sizes in classrooms and improve student attention.

To this they add the elimination of bureaucratic overload through a plan negotiated with the union majority and a review of the current curricula counting on the opinion of the teaching staff. In parallel to the strikes, the centers have already organized themselves to apply other pressure measures, such as stopping doing school trips or not correcting research papers.
